HS Code 87131000: Invalid carriages, not mechanically propelled

Invalid carriages, not mechanically propelled, fall under the HS Code 87131000. This code is used to classify and categorize these specific types of vehicles for trade and customs purposes. Let's explore more about this HS Code and the product it represents.

Invalid carriages are designed to assist people with mobility impairments. These vehicles provide a means of transportation for individuals who are unable to walk or have limited mobility. They usually come in the form of wheelchairs or mobility scooters, providing a convenient and accessible mode of transportation for those in need.

The HS Code 87131000 specifically refers to invalid carriages that are not mechanically propelled. This means that these vehicles are not powered by an engine or motor. Instead, they are manually operated, either by the passenger themselves or through assistance from a caregiver or attendant.

When it comes to international trade, the HS Code is used to identify and classify goods for customs and tariff purposes. It helps determine the appropriate duties and taxes that need to be paid when importing or exporting these products. The HS Code 87131000 ensures that invalid carriages, not mechanically propelled, are properly categorized and regulated.
